Absolutely put the rabbit to sleep. Had mine 5-6 months, just love it. The magazine holds about 30 bbs and the two co2 cartridges. I get almost four reloads of bbs per the two cartridges. Closer to 3 if I'm heavy on the full auto. And I am. The power is probably 50% more than your standard "Red Ryder" type. Maybe a little stronger at first. Of all people Bud K had the best price lately. Paid retail for mine, had to have it. Not sorry, gettin' old, need toys... Wal-Mart online was the best on cartridges and bbs.You have to install the cartridges in a specific order, it's kinda in the small print. If you put the wrong on first it just dumps. Doesn't hurt anything, just lose that cart.. You won't regret it, it's a blasst.
